Year: 1972 Source: Journal of Abnormal Psychology, v.80, no.3, (1972), p.211-224 SIEC No: 19850746

Self-destructive behavior is discussed in terms of frequency of occurrence, type of behavior, susceptible persons, causation & possible treatment methods. Behavioral therapies involving positive reinforcement of alternative behaviors, withdrawal of positive reinforcement, extinction & punishment, are reviewed & evaluated. A discriminative stimulus-conditioned reinforcer hypothesis & an avoidance hypothesis are proposed to explain self-destructive behavior in terms of learning principles.
